On 09-Dec, Ludlow Jute & Specialities Ltd experienced a notable decline in its share price, falling by 4.18% to close at ₹280.00. This drop reflects a continuation of recent downward momentum, with the stock underperforming both its sector and the broader market benchmarks.




Recent Price Movement and Market Performance


The stock has been on a downward trajectory for the past four consecutive days, cumulatively losing approximately 13.7% in returns during this period. This sustained decline contrasts sharply with the broader market, as the Sensex has remained relatively stable, registering only a marginal weekly loss of 0.55%. Over the past month, Ludlow Jute’s share price has fallen by 25.84%, while the Sensex has gained 1.74%, highlighting the stock’s significant underperformance against the benchmark.


Despite this short-term weakness, the stock’s year-to-date (YTD) and longer-term returns remain robust. Ludlow Jute has delivered an 8.93% gain YTD, slightly outperforming the Sensex’s 8.35% rise. Over the last year, the stock has surged by 25.67%, substantially outpacing the Sensex’s 3.87% increase. Its three- and five-year returns are particularly impressive, with gains exceeding 200%, far surpassing the benchmark’s respective 36.16% and 83.64% growth. This indicates that while the recent price action is negative, the company has demonstrated strong performance over the medium to long term.

Intraday Trading and Technical Indicators


On 09-Dec, Ludlow Jute opened with a gap down of 3.83%, signalling immediate selling pressure from the outset of trading. The stock reached an intraday low of ₹278.5, representing a 4.69% decline from the previous close. Such a gap down opening and intraday weakness often reflect negative sentiment or profit-taking by investors.


Technically, the stock is trading below all key moving averages, including the 5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day averages. This broad-based weakness across multiple timeframes suggests a bearish trend and may discourage short-term buyers. The failure to hold above these technical support levels often triggers further selling as traders adjust their positions.


Investor Participation and Liquidity


Interestingly, despite the price decline, investor participation has increased significantly. Delivery volume on 08-Dec surged by 252.51% compared to the five-day average, reaching 4,540 shares. This heightened activity indicates that while some investors are offloading shares, others may be accumulating at lower levels, anticipating a potential rebound or valuing the stock’s longer-term prospects.


Liquidity remains adequate for trading, with the stock’s average traded value supporting sizeable transactions without excessive price impact. This ensures that market participants can enter or exit positions with relative ease, which is crucial during volatile periods.

Contextualising the Decline


The recent price fall in Ludlow Jute shares appears to be driven primarily by short-term profit-taking and technical selling rather than fundamental deterioration. The absence of any positive or negative dashboard data suggests no new material news has influenced the stock. Instead, the decline aligns with a correction phase following strong gains over the past year and several years prior.


Moreover, the stock’s underperformance relative to its sector by 5.31% today further emphasises the pressure it faces in the near term. Investors may be cautious amid broader market uncertainties or sector-specific challenges, prompting a reassessment of valuations and risk exposure.


Nevertheless, the company’s solid long-term track record and rising delivery volumes hint at underlying investor confidence in its fundamentals. This dichotomy between short-term weakness and long-term strength is common in stocks undergoing consolidation after significant rallies.


Outlook for Investors


For investors, the current decline in Ludlow Jute’s share price offers both caution and opportunity. The technical downtrend advises prudence, especially for short-term traders, while the increased participation and strong historical returns may attract long-term investors seeking value at lower price points.


Monitoring the stock’s ability to reclaim key moving averages and observing sector trends will be critical in assessing whether the recent weakness is a temporary correction or the start of a more prolonged downturn.
